About Leichhardt 2040

The size of Leichhardt is approximately 2.6 square kilometres. It has 16 parks covering nearly 6.6% of total area. The population of Leichhardt in 2011 was 13,519 people. By 2016 the population was 14,608 showing a population growth of 8.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Leichhardt is 30-39 years. Households in Leichhardt are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Leichhardt work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 57.8% of the homes in Leichhardt were owner-occupied compared with 57.6% in 2016.

Leichhardt has 8,741 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Leichhardt have seen a 28.49%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 3.50% increase. As at 31 January 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Leichhardt is $2,064,377 while the median value for Units is $1,035,862.
  • Houses have a median rent of $900 while Units have a median rent of $730.
There are currently 36 properties listed for sale, and 31 properties listed for rent in Leichhardt on OnTheHouse. According to CoreLogic's data, 431 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Leichhardt.
